Television broadcast stations: 3 (1997) Televisions: 57,000 (1992 est.) Transportation Railways: 0 km Highways: total: 225 km paved: 225 km unpaved: 0 km (1997 est.) note: in addition, there are 232 km of paved and unpaved roads that are privately owned Ports and harbors: Hamilton, Saint George Merchant marine: total: 97 ships (1,000 GRT or over) totaling 4,647,576 GRT/7,612,686 DWT ships by type: bulk 18, cargo 3, chemical tanker 1, container 20, liquefied gas tanker 7, oil tanker 27, refrigerated cargo 15, roll-on/roll-off cargo 4, short-sea passenger 2 note: a flag of convenience registry; includes ships from 11 countries among which are UK 24, Canada 12, Hong Kong 11, US 11, Nigeria 4, Sweden 4, Norway 3, and Switzerland 2 (1998 est.) Airports: 1 (1998 est.) Airports--with paved runways: total: 1 2,438 to 3,047 m: 1 (1998 est.)
